The Dawson County High School varsity Tigers' men's soccer team went 1-1-1 at the Tournament of Champions tournament held in Jekyll Island last weekend.

Coach Jed Lacey's team defeated The Walker School, 2-1, on March 12, lost to Wheeler, 2-1, on March 13, and tied Creekview, 1-1, on March 14.

Against Walker (4-3-1) Sal Mendoza and Dennis Pyetsukh scored goals in the win.

Brandon Lund scored the lone goal against Wheeler (4-0-0) and David Velasquez snuck a shot by the goalie against Creekview (1-5-1).

The No. 1 ranked Tigers are now 5-1-2 overall this season.

"It was a good weekend. The competition was great, that was the reason why we went to this tournament. These are the types of teams we will see at state," Lacey said.

"We had a chance to win all three games, but we couldn't find a way to finish. We are going to have to fix this. After this tournament we always make the final adjustments going into the state tournament."

Lacey praised the play of Lund.

"Brandon Lund had a good tournament and almost pulled off a miracle against Creekview, stealing the ball from a Creekview defender and made some amazing moves to get his shot off with only five seconds remaining. He hit the pole, which would have won the game for us."

Up next for Dawson County will be a trip to Fannin County for a 7:30 p.m. start on Friday.
